Clean beauty with a Singapore heart: Local skincare, cosmetics brands ride on new trend

At least six home-grown brands promoting their skincare products as organic, sustainable and vegan or cruelty-free have launched in the past year

After years of using over-the-counter brands and prescriptive creams to treat her facial acne issues with little satisfactory results, Ms Hildra Gwee decided to take matters into her own hands.

Two years ago, the 34-year-old started reading up on natural remedies and concocted her own blend of facial oil, which she said gradually cleared her skin up more effectively than any other products she had tried before.
